Works well for most things, 2008-09-09 I purchased this microwave about a year ago and have been pleased with it for the most part. It has consistent heating over the whole food and is quite powerful for the price. The size is also a welcome feature, in that my previous microwave was about 0.7 cubic feet. The stainless steel is easy to clean and adds a contemporary look to the kitchen. My favorite feature is probably the popcorn button which quite literally pops exactly the number of kernels in the bag without burning the popcorn. It is not a feature-filled microwave, but has warm, soften, reheat and defrost options. I only use the defrost beside the cook because I never took the time to determine how they work. Unfortunately the defrost is the only major flaw I can find with the microwave. It is not terribly difficult to use, but as far as I can tell you are unable to "tell" the microwave that you want to cook anything over 2 lbs. Aside from that it is a solid built, good powered, cheap and easy to use.

Works well so far; LCD fogs up, 2008-07-30 Have only had for a few days, so perhaps a review is premature? Regardless, it arrived in good working condition, and is a microwave. Is there much else to say?
On the negative side, from day one, nuke one, the LCD panel fogs up from steam from the inside of the microwave I'd assume. Now, I'm no electronics design guru, but that can't be good sign for the life of the internal components.
It replaced my old Amana, which was over 20 years old, working like a champ, but starting to spark a bit. That thing was half microwave, half Russian nuclear sub. Somehow I'm doubting this one will make the 20 year mark.
